Price for Lecithins and Other Phosphoaminolipids in Algeria (CIF) - 2022

The average lecithins and other phosphoaminolipids import price stood at $911 per ton in 2022, reducing by -4.3% against the previous year. Overall, the import price saw a perceptible shrinkage.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2020 an increase of 39% against the previous year. Over the period under review, average import prices reached the maximum at $1,399 per ton in 2012; however, from 2013 to 2022, import prices remained at a lower figure.

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Germany ($6,377 per ton), while the price for Tunisia ($390 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Germany (+16.5%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ced mixed trend patterns.

Imports of Lecithins and Other Phosphoaminolipids in Algeria

In 2022, purchases abroad of lecithins and other phosphoaminolipidses was finally on the rise to reach 1.1K tons after two years of decline. Overall, imports, however, faced a deep reduction.

In value terms, lecithins and other phosphoaminolipids imports expanded notably to $1M in 2022. Over the period under review, imports, however, continue to indicate a deep reduction.
